The ingredients needed to make Ordinary French Toast:
  1. Prepare 4 Eggs
  2. Take 1 Splash of milk
  3. Take 1 tsp Cinnamon
  4. Get 6 slice Texas toast bread
  5. Take 1 Shakes powdered sugar
Steps to make Ordinary French Toast:
  1. Crack and scramble 4 eggs in a dish large enough to soak the bread
  2. Add a splash of milk
  3. Add teaspoon of Cinnamon. Mix all the ingredients together
  4. Heat a large non stick skillet
  5. Soak bread on both sides in your egg mixture
  6. Add bread to skillet and cook. If your skillet is hot enough you should be able to only cook on each side for about 3 minutes. You don't want it to be soggy but at the same time not to dry and burnt.
  7. Add to plate. A dollop of butter on top, a few drizzle of maple syrup, and a few shakes of powdered sugar! Enjoy!
